Итак, у меня есть вид рециркулятора с горизонтальным StaggeredGridLayoutManager. Представление рециркулятора инициализируется при запуске приложения, но не отображается, пока вы не нажмете кнопку, поэтому элементы не будут связаны сразу. То, что я пытаюсь сделать, это изменить количество промежутков в моем макете в зависимости от общей ширины элементов, но, поскольку они не связаны перед отображением, вызывается метод определения количества промежутков перед onBindViewHolder элементы, где установлена их ширина. Мне было интересно, есть ли какой-нибудь слушатель, который я мог бы использовать для повторного выполнения метода вычисления диапазона. Заранее спасибо!